70336 is a even composite number that follows 70335 and precedes 70337. It is composed of 28 distinct factors: 1, 2, 4, 7, 8, 14, 16, 28, 32, 56, 64, 112, 157, 224, 314, 448, 628, 1099, 1256, 2198, 2512, 4396, 5024, 8792, 10048, 17584, 35168, 70336. Its prime factorization can be written as 2^6 × 7 × 157. 70336 is classified as a abundant number based on the sum of its proper divisors. In computer science, 70336 is represented as 10001001011000000 in binary and 112C0 in hexadecimal.
